Public bug reported:

I shut down my computer... waited long enough I figured - and closed the
lid. Came back hours later to find it had suspended instead of shutting
down. I think this is probably the bug, not the resume failure.

In any case, after opening the lid, it sort of resumed and then
continued to shut down as originally intended.

IMO,once the shutdown signal is received it should override a suspend
signal from the lid closing. Otherwise you have to sit and stare at the
computer to make sure it does what it's asked - and that's... not good.
